Internal Medicine
Experts in Adult Health
Specialists in internal medicine are experts in adult health and specially trained to solve diagnostic problems. They often serve as the primary care physician for adult patients, and focus on the prevention, diagnosis and treatment of disease. They give regular physical exams, offer preventive care, suggest routine health screenings and manage a broad range of adult health conditions, including most non-surgical illnesses such as high blood pressure or diabetes. In most cases, internal medicine physicians refer severe or unusual cases to an appropriate medical specialist.
